If you have a warm red brick on your home, one of the most popular colors to paint the siding on the home is white or cream. White or cream helps the red brick color to pop, helping to ensure that the brick is the star of the exterior of your home. Additionally, white and cream paired with red brick is a classic … See more White and cream siding pairs beautifully with bright red brick, but it is a tricky color option to maintain. WebAug 20, 2024 · Orange Brick: The siding color could be riverway, sage green, and cream. Brown Brick: A blue-gray or tundra gray siding color will do. Tan Brick: The smokey gray color siding suits tan bricks best. Choosing the right siding color if you have brick walls can help you maintain the accent of the bricks without it overpowering the design. WebBrick generally comes in red, orange, yellowish-tan and dark brown colors. Architectural features like bump-outs can be minimized with a darker shade or maximized with a shade or two lighter than the rest of the home. Consider the color of your roof, whether it’s black, gray or brown.
